FreeWheel, a Comcast company, provides comprehensive ad platforms for publishers, advertisers, and media buyers. Powered by premium video content, robust data, and advanced technology, we’re making it easier for buyers and sellers to transact across all screens, data types, and sales channels.

As a global company, we have offices in nine countries and can insert advertisements around the world.

Job Summary

We are looking for a data guru who, as a Senior Product Manager, can play an instrumental role in defining the future of adtech identity at FreeWheel.

The successful candidate will use their analytical skills to infer critical insights from large data sets, defining and refining strategy as the Identity landscape evolves.

As a Senior Product Manager, you will work closely with Product, Partnerships, Customer Support, Sales, Marketing, Finance, Data Science, and Engineering teams to provide strategic clarity that unifies and inspires the team to deliver meaningful results to our buy and sell-side customers.

You will lead strategic projects to measure the health of our integrations, run exploratory data projects to find new opportunities, and deliver product features to the market.
